Agartala: May 08: Dr. Rajdeep Roy, the national in-charge (Prabhari) for Tripura BJP, chaired a significant review meeting on Thursday at the party’s state headquarters to assess the progress of various ongoing national campaigns. The meeting was attended by key party leaders, including Tripura BJP President Rajib Bhattacharjee and State General Secretary Bhagaban Das.

Speaking to the media after the meeting, Dr. Roy emphasized the importance of the ongoing campaigns being carried out by the BJP across the country, including in Tripura. “As the Prabhari of Tripura Pradesh BJP, I have come here to actively participate in and oversee the progress of several important national campaigns. These campaigns are crucial to our party’s vision for the nation,” Dr. Roy said.

He highlighted three major initiatives currently being promoted: the campaign for ‘One Nation, One Election’, the amendment of the Waqf Act, and the campaign centered around Dr. B.R. Ambedkar and the Indian Constitution. Dr. Roy stressed that these initiatives are of national significance and form a core part of the BJP’s outreach and ideological engagement with the public.

The meeting was aimed at not just reviewing the status of the campaigns in Tripura but also strategizing further action to enhance their impact at the grassroots level. Dr. Roy also expressed his intention to participate personally in these campaigns during his visit to the state.

State leaders, including Rajib Bhattacharjee and Bhagaban Das, reaffirmed their commitment to successfully implement the campaigns and ensure widespread public awareness. The BJP leadership in Tripura sees these initiatives as vital to strengthening the party’s connection with the people and aligning the state’s political narrative with national priorities.

The visit by Dr. Roy underlines the importance the central leadership places on Tripura as part of its broader political and organizational strategy.
